Market Overview
Rockville is pricier ($560K median vs $370K), a difference of about $190K. Rockville moves faster, with homes averaging 17 days on market compared to 28 in Williamsburg. Williamsburg offers a lower entry point at $150K–$1.5M.

Schools
Rockville leads on school quality with a 85% average pass rate (rated Excellent) compared to 84% in Williamsburg. Top schools in Rockville include Richard Montgomery High School and Thomas S. Wootton High School. In Williamsburg, families look to Lafayette High School and Warhill High School. See Rockville schools | See Williamsburg schools

Commute
Williamsburg is closer to downtown at ~25 minutes vs ~30 minutes. Rockville has 3 Metro stations, including Rockville on the Red line. Major highway access: Rockville (I-270, I-495, Rt 355), Williamsburg (I-64, Rt 60, Rt 199).

Walkability
Rockville is more walkable with a Walk Score of 52 (Somewhat Walkable), compared to 35 in Williamsburg. Transit scores: Rockville (42) vs Williamsburg (10). Walkability varies significantly by neighborhood. Urban corridors like Rockville Town Center and Colonial Williamsburg score much higher than suburban areas.

Frequently Asked Questions
Is Rockville or Williamsburg more affordable?
Williamsburg is more affordable with a median home price of $370K, compared to $560K in Rockville. Both cities offer a wide range of housing options, from condos and townhomes to single-family homes. Rockville prices range from $200K–$1.8M. Williamsburg prices range from $150K–$1.5M.
Which has better schools, Rockville or Williamsburg?
Rockville has stronger schools overall, with a 85% average pass rate compared to 84% in Williamsburg. Top schools in Rockville include Richard Montgomery High School and Thomas S. Wootton High School. In Williamsburg, standout schools include Lafayette High School and Warhill High School. School quality varies by neighborhood, so check specific school zones when evaluating homes.
Which is easier to commute from, Rockville or Williamsburg?
Williamsburg has the shorter commute to downtown at ~25 minutes vs ~30 minutes. Rockville has Metro access (Rockville). Williamsburg has no direct Metro access.
